The sixth and seventh books of moses is an 18th or 19thcentury magical text allegedly written by moses, and passed down as hidden or lost books of the hebrew bible. The socalled sixth and seventh books of moses in particular consists of a collection of texts which purport to explain the magic whereby moses won the biblical magic contest with the egyptian priestmagicians, parted the red sea, and other miraculous feats.
